Transaction 72ad573e469546aebd8088ffe3ba68a4c39db52be1cb59156b2c7418fce7d46c
1 Input
1 Output
-
72ad573e469546aebd8088ffe3ba68a4c39db52be1cb59156b2c7418fce7d46c:0
- value
- 2701000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dbf94a15467fc95d33f5a5c823a95eee7cf1c5d OP_EQUAL
- address
- 3EcWhqvi6RsST4FaaricfscM7NvmYmeZLA